Output 3ac0440cce4af3e842776cd8e0611790431123cd8168cbc0680a1128b982aa24:0

value
398146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c555e0c6d309d2306d96f27eab60a0310e8fa0 OP_EQUAL
address
3DLc91nmyHQSFBxiTBxHqLJvpBWXoMnHEU
transaction
3ac0440cce4af3e842776cd8e0611790431123cd8168cbc0680a1128b982aa24
spent
true